Four ships of the United States Navy have been named Bold.USS Bold (AMc-67), originally named Chief, was a minesweeper laid down on 27 August 1941 at South Bristol, Maine.
USS Bold (BAT-8), was a tugboat transferred to the United Kingdom on 29 June 1942.
USS Bold (AM-424), was a minesweeper laid down 12 December 1951 and launched 14 March 1953.
USNS Bold (T-AGOS-12), was an ocean surveillance ship, commissioned as USNS Vigorous in 1989 and later renamed.
